TRIAL CHAMBER III ("Trial Chamber") of the International Tribunal for the Prosecution of Persons Responsible for Serious Violations of International Humanitarian Law Committed in the Territory of the Former Yugoslavia since 1991 ("Tribunal");

BEING SEIZED OF "Submission No 100" filed on 3 August 2005 by Vojislav Seselj, whereby he requests an extension of "the deadline for submission of a response for 14 days after the end on the ban on telephone communication";

NOTING that on 4 July 2005 and 7 July 2005 the President of the Tribunal issued orders regarding the special composition of Trial Chamber III for the purpose of determining the Prosecution Motions for Joinder of the cases of the Prosecutor v. Milan Martic, the Prosecutor v. Jovica Stanisic and Franko Simatovic and the Prosecutor v. Vojislav Seselj;1

NOTING that on 30 May 2005 and 1 June 2005 the Prosecution filed a motion for the joinder of these three cases ("Motion for Joinder"). The Motion was filed with respect to the cases of the Prosecutor v. Milan Martic and the Prosecutor v. Jovica Stanisic and Franko Simatovic;2

NOTING that in the case of the Prosecutor v. Vojislav Seselj motions submitted to the Registry have not been considered to be officially filed unless accompanied by an official translation into either English or BCS, as appropriate;

NOTING that on 19 July 2005 the Prosecution Motion for Joinder, accompanied by an official translation of the Motion for Joinder into the BCS language, was filed with respect to the case of the Prosecutor v. Vojislav Seselj;3

NOTING that on 13 June 2005 the Defence Counsel of the Accused Milan Martic filed a response to the Prosecution Motion for Joinder;4

NOTING that on 29 June 2005 the Defence Counsel of the Accused Jovica Stanisic and the Defence Counsel of the Accused Franko Simatovic filed responses to the Prosecution Motion for Joinder;5

NOTING "Scheduling Order" filed 20 July 2005 instructing Vojislav Seselj to file a response to the Prosecution Motion for Joinder within fourteen days of 19 July 2005;

CONSIDERING that the issue of communication restriction is primarily a matter for the Registry;

CONSIDERING HOWEVER, that the response of Accused Milan Martic and the responses of Accused Jovica Stanisic and Franko Simatovic will not be translated into BCS and transmitted to the Accused Vojislav Seselj until the end of August and that in those special circumstances an extension of time is warranted;

PURSUANT TO Rule 127 of the Rules of Procedure and Evidence of the Tribunal:

GRANTS the Motion, in part, and ORDERS Vojislav Seselj to file his response, if any, by Monday, 5 September 2005;
